What does a software engineer do in Mauritius?

A Software Engineer in Mauritius is responsible for designing, developing, testing, and maintaining software applications and systems. They work in various industries such as finance, telecommunications, and IT services, often collaborating with teams to create solutions tailored to business needs. The role may involve writing code, troubleshooting issues, and ensuring software meets quality and security standards. With the growing tech sector in Mauritius, software engineers play a key role in driving digital transformation and innovation.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a software engineer in Mauritius,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Software Engineer in Mauritius, you typically need a degree in computer science or a related field, strong programming skills in languages like Java, Python, or C#, and a solid understanding of software development principles. Familiarity with version control systems (such as Git), cloud platforms, and frameworks like Angular or React is highly valued, along with relevant certifications. Problem-solving, teamwork, and effective communication are crucial soft skills that distinguish top performers in this role. These competencies are vital for delivering reliable software solutions, collaborating efficiently with teams, and adapting to the evolving needs of clients and employers.

What are some unique challenges software engineers in Mauritius might face when working with international teams?

Software Engineers in Mauritius often collaborate with colleagues and clients from different time zones, which can require flexible working hours and strong communication skills to ensure projects stay on track. Additionally, there may be occasional challenges in accessing certain global technology resources or platforms due to regional restrictions, making it important to stay adaptable and resourceful. However, these challenges provide valuable experience in remote collaboration and problem-solving, which are highly regarded in the tech industry.

Position Summary
As a Senior Software Engineer - Digital Products, you will play a key role within the Digital Product team, driving the design, development, and delivery of scalable SaaS solutions and digital products. You will collaborate closely with Product Managers, Data Teams, UX/UI Designers, Quality Engineers, and Infrastructure Teams to ensure our products are technically sound, user-focused, and aligned with business goals.

You will lead technical design and implementation for medium to large-sized digital initiatives, contribute to architectural decisions, and guide a team of engineers on best practices. You will actively participate in discovery, framing, iterative development, and continuous improvement of digital products, helping to translate product vision into high-quality, maintainable solutions.

This position is based out of our corporate offices in Reading. PA. This an office first position, at least 4 days in office.

Key Responsibilities
Lead engineering efforts across the full product lifecycle (discovery, framing, design, development, testing, release, and support) in alignment with the SVPG product framework. 
Collaborate with Product Managers to translate product vision, user needs, and data insights into technical requirements and actionable development plans. 
Design and recommend scalable, reusable, and maintainable software architectures for digital and SaaS applications. 
Guide engineering teams in adopting modern development best practices, CI/CD pipelines, and cloud-native approaches. 
Partner with cross-functional teams (Data, QA, Design, Infrastructure) to ensure solutions are secure, performant, and meet business objectives. 
Participate in design and deploy tollgate reviews, gaining buy-in from Architects, QA, Security, and Operations. 
Mentor and coach engineers, providing technical guidance, code reviews, and feedback to support professional growth. 
Oversee multiple medium to large-sized projects, ensuring on-time delivery and alignment with quality standards. 
Troubleshoot and optimize software performance, resolving technical issues in production and pre-release environments. 
Document systems, architecture, and dependencies to maintain clarity and knowledge sharing across teams. 
Conduct technical interviews and contribute to hiring decisions for the Digital Product Engineering team.

Qualifications
Bachelor's Deg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, or equivalent practical experience; Master's preferred. 
10+ years of software development experience, including full-stack development for SaaS or digital products. 
Proficiency in modern web technologies and frameworks: React, Angular, jQuery, HTML, CSS, JavaScript, Spring/Spring-MVC, myBatis, RESTful APIs. 
2-4 years of experience contributing to Agile product teams; 1-2 years leading medium to large digital projects. 
Experience in designing cloud-native, scalable, and reusable architectures for enterprise-grade SaaS applications. 
Strong knowledge of the software development lifecycle, design patterns, and architectural best practices. 
Ability to take ownership of multiple applications and prioritize work in a fast-paced digital environment. 
Excellent communication skills for collaborating with Product, Design, Data, and Infrastructure teams. 
Experience in mentoring engineers, conducting technical interviews, and developing high-performing teams. 
Understanding of SVPG Product Operating Model principles, including discovery, framing, and iterative delivery. 
Ability to estimate project timelines, define technical requirements, and guide teams to successful outcomes.
